Use the FCP Manual
Wednesday, 04 March 2009

I admit, I am not a Final Cut Pro genius. I have been using Final Cut for years, but like many programs out there, I work on a need to know basis. Meaning, I don't know that much about the parts of FCP that I don't use. Doing these tutorials for our website has sent me on a quest for topics to cover that I have never dealt with personally.

Because of this I am reminded that the best resource besides the internet, which isn't always that helpful anyways, is FCP's own User Manual! No not that huge book that comes in the box, but the digital version. It has a great search feature as long as you use the right wording because it does tend to pick out a lot of fragmented words. Check out the User Manual by running HELP>>FINAL CUT PRO USERS MANUAL. What's really cool is that you can click on the table of contents and be taken directly to the page you need to be on. It's a very quick way to tips on anything, from formats to exports and even some documentation on filters. So when you combine tutorials on the internet with the user manual, you are sure to solve many a problem.
